On Jan 19, 2013, at 1:07 PM, John Panarese <jpanarese@xxxxxxxxx> wrote:

>    You can look in the Text to Speech tab of Dictation and Speech 
> preferences.  You can change the system voice there and make adjustments to 
> it.
